Where do you get the spinner in Twilight Princess?

Where do you get the spinner in Twilight Princess?

the Arbiter’s Grounds
Twilight Princess The Spinner is found in the Arbiter’s Grounds after defeating Death Sword. As the main dungeon item, it must be used in order to progress through the second half of the dungeon. It is also necessary to defeat the dungeon’s boss, Stallord.

How do you do the spin attack in Twilight Princess?

Link performing a Spin Attack in Twilight Princess In the Nintendo GameCube version of Twilight Princess, Link can perform the Spin Attack by pressing the sword button to charge it or rotating the control stick and pressing the sword button once.

How do you do the spin attack?

The Spin Attack is done in most Zelda games by holding down the button that the sword is assigned to for a matter of time and then releasing it. This will cause Link to get in a fighting stance while he charges up his sword or, in the case of the 2D Zelda games, just stand still as the sword begins to glow.

How do you beat the ball and chain guy?

Darkhammer will continuously guard his body with his massive Ball and Chain. In order to defeat him, Link must Clawshot a target behind Darkhammer as soon as he starts swinging his weapon. Darkhammer will then pause to pull in his weapon, giving Link the opportunity to attack his exposed tail.

What does the Dominion Rod do?

The Dominion Rod is found in the eighth floor of the Temple of Time, obtained after defeating a Darknut. By using the Dominion Rod, Link can bring to life certain statues, causing them to mimic his movements. Pressing the button that the Dominion Rod is set to causes the statue to perform an attack.

Where do you find the spinner in Twilight Princess?

The Spinner is an item from The Legend of Zelda: Twilight Princess. It is an ancient device found within the Arbiter’s Grounds, and its appearance is that of a large top with a gear along the outer edge. The Spinner has three main uses.

What does spinner do in Legend of Zelda?

The Spinner also features a spin attack that Link can use to hurt nearby enemies. Additionally, if Link uses the Spinner before falling or jumping off a high cliff, he will be slowed down considerably and take no damage upon landing. He can also control his descent as he falls.

Where does the Twilight Princess take place in The Legend of Zelda?

In-depth guide: Twilight Princess Walkthrough. The Legend of Zelda: Twilight Princess (トワイライトプリンセス) is the 13th installment in The Legend of Zelda series. This game’s story takes place after the Child Ending of Ocarina of Time, when Zelda sent Link back in time to prevent the events of Ocarina of Time and allowed Link to live out his childhood.
